Output e32fbe4ceb5c07a5f83489c379e247d2fde9cab65eed8627032625a317745a55:0

value
703429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83e417f958b840818b1ae4cda65920dda1ff28f8 OP_EQUAL
address
3DiPgu3NUKFPdDdZcRoH3FC1MPNCJgATfS
transaction
e32fbe4ceb5c07a5f83489c379e247d2fde9cab65eed8627032625a317745a55
confirmations
208155
spent
true